Concept to construction
A concept is an abstract or initial idea that can form part of a plan or strategy. It is often described as a type of mental representation. In terms of construction, a concept is generally the initial idea for a project or development.
Concept structural design proposals from a structural engineer might include: Preferred foundation design. Frame system. Structural grid with column sizes. Primary and secondary beam sizes and spans. Schedules of floor loadings catering for dead and live loads.
Concept services design proposals from a services engineer might include: Weights and location of major plant and equipment. Energy targets. Insulation assumptions. Routes for the distribution of horizontal services runs including access provisions.
